Research Lab UT and Drexel University use the NI LabVIEW Modulation Toolkit in Wireless Research Researchers at The University of Texas at Austin and Drexel University use the NI LabVIEW Modulation Toolkit in wireless (MIMO) research. NI recently introduced a new version of the toolkit that delivers advanced processing capabilities. Read more about the application. Click here for more information on the LabVIEW Modulation Toolkit. Texas A&M uses the NI LabVIEW Control Design Toolkit and LabVIEW Simulation Module for Novel PID Control Technique Texas A&M developed computer-aided design tools for fixed-order and PID controllers with guaranteed stability, performance, and robustness using the NI LabVIEW graphical development environment, LabVIEW Control Design Toolkit, and LabVIEW Simulation Module.
